In Graft, Maggie MacKellar describes a year on a merino wool farm on the east coast of Tasmania, and all of life - and death - that surrounds her through the cycle of lambing seasons.

This book is the author's thanksgiving for a place and a moment in motherhood; and a timely reminder of the inescapable elemental laws of nature.
